For ASIF Ventures second podcast, we interviewed Melissa Wijngaarden; Co-Founder of ASIF's portfolio company, Project Cece. Project Cece is a sustainable and fair trade fashion marketplace for locally-produced and environmentally friendly clothing.
What is the best way to launch and grow a startup in the sustainable fashion industry? What are the implications of having an all-female founding team? In this episode of ASIF Ventures podcast, we discuss questions such as these while taking a deep-dive into the story of Project Cece.
